Vulnerable Satellites Guide Global Conflicts
The increasing reliance on Global Navigation Satellite Systems (GNSS) – primarily GPS – for a vast range of applications, from everyday navigation to critical military operations, is creating a dangerous vulnerability. Experts are warning that attacks targeting these systems could have devastating consequences for global economies and reshape modern warfare. This dependence is rapidly becoming a significant security concern.
The core issue lies in the interconnectedness of our world. Billions of devices – smartphones, cars, logistics networks, and military equipment – rely on GNSS for accurate positioning and timing. Disrupting these systems, through jamming, spoofing, or even destruction of satellites, could paralyze these networks, causing widespread economic chaos and hindering military operations. Recent geopolitical tensions have heightened concerns, with nations reportedly developing more sophisticated methods to target GNSS. Furthermore, the relatively low cost of attack compared to the potential damage makes these systems an increasingly attractive target for adversaries, prompting calls for greater redundancy and alternative navigation solutions.
